Dr. Sarah Von Biberstein, MD is a head & neck surgery otolaryngologist in Wilmington, NC. Dr. Von Biberstein has extensive experience in "Ear, Nose, & Throat Surgical Procedures", Otologic Conditions & Procedures, and Upper Respiratory Conditions. She is affiliated with Novant Health New Hanover Regional Medical Center. She is accepting new patients.
